Leah duCharme named District Court Judge based in Moorhead

MOORHEAD, Minn. (KVRR) – Governor Tim Walz announced Leah duCharme is replacing Seventh Judicial District Judge Amber B. Gustafson who announced her resignation. According to the governor’s office, duCharme is a senior shareholder at Gjesdahl Law practicing primarily family law, including marriage dissolutions, child custody, paternity, child and spousal support, domestic violence, protective orders, adoption, and guardianships. Update: Fire destroys house near Moorhead

House fire 12/8/2021 (courtesy, KFGO)MOORHEAD, Minn. (KVRR) – Fire destroyed a home south of Moorhead shortly before 8:00 a.m. Wednesday.  The fire was in the 4400 block of Highway 52. Clay County Sheriff Mark Empting says two people got out by jumping from a second-floor window.  They were taken to a hospital with minor injuries.  Some pets inside the house…
